Choosing a Water Softener Based on Your Needs

When selecting the perfect water softener for your home, one crucial consideration to consider is grain capacity. Grain capacity refers to the volume of hard water that a softener can treat before needing to be refilled. A smaller size may work for a small household, while larger groups will benefit from a larger capacity softener to provide consistently soft water.

Estimate your household's demand by considering the number of people, appliances, and daily chores. This will help you figure out the ideal grain capacity to meet your needs and prevent frequent recharge cycles.

Remember, a properly sized water softener will not only provide pleasant soft water but also minimize water waste and increase the life of your appliances.
